Head coach Gary van Egmond has named his extended squad for Friday night’s clash against Brisbane Roar at Suncorp Stadium.
Western Sydney Wanderers will head to Queensland on Friday night to face Brisbane Roar at Suncorp Stadium, with both sides eager to build momentum as the Isuzu UTE A-League season nears its final stretch. The Wanderers come off a narrow 2-1 loss to Newcastle Jets, where Bozhidar Kraev gave them an early lead before the Jets struck twice in the second half to snatch the win.
Brisbane Roar’s last outing was a 1-1 draw with Perth Glory. Chris Long opened the scoring before an own goal from Youstin Salas levelled the contest. The Roar also lost both starting strikers to injury, leaving questions over their attacking options heading into Friday’s match.
With both teams outside the top six, this clash is a key chance to gain ground. The Wanderers will look to respond with a strong road performance, while Brisbane will aim to make home advantage count as they push for finals contention.
